Dimapur, December 27 (MExN): Chairman of the NSCN/GPRN, Isak Chishi Swu, extends Christmas greetings. A message from Swu received here said, “All creation lied in hopelessness and longed for salvation” because of sin. “Humanity fell short of the glory of God. To save humankind from the bondage of sin God sent the Saviour Jesus Christ here on earth,” his message stated.
“My dear Naga people, nothing is greater than his act of love of sending his only begotten son as the savior of the whole world and his creation. Saving humankind is his greatest work of love. Apart from Christ, there is no salvation. To value and accomplish the race entirely depends on us,” Swu stated. The NSCN/GPRN leader’s message during Christmas is that “we fear not the adversaries but we realize that the seriousness of our own sins has been the greatest hurdle today towards an honorable solution to our issue.”
To be for Christ is the ‘only right decision for us today,’ he explained. “To struggle against the evil will lead the Naga people to strive for good. The hope for the future lies in obedience and total submission to Christ. He is the answer to our everlasting quest for freedom. Therefore Nagalim will be for Christ,” Swu stated. “May the name of our Lord Jesus Christ be glorified in Naga nation. Wishing you all a merry Christmas and a prosperous new year.”
